// C++ program to illustrate std::plus// by adding the respective elements of 2 arrays#include<iostream> // std::cout#include<functional> // std::plus#include<algorithm> // std::transformintmain(){// First arrayintfirst[] = {1,2,3,4,5};// Second arrayintsecond[] = {10,20,30...
示例运行此代码 #include <functional> #include <iostream> int main() { std::string a = "Hello "; const char* b = "world"; std::cout << std::plus<>{}(a, b) << '\n'; } 输出: Hello world 收藏0 分享到微信 分享到QQ 分享到微博 ...
std::move和std::forward只是执行转换的函数(确切的说应该是函数模板)。std::move无条件的将它的参数...
看到这个题目想必大家都猜到了,昨天的文章又有问题了。。。今天,又和两位大佬交流了一下YOLOV3损失...
The first version performs comparisons with operator #include #include using namespace std; struct PlusOne { bool operator()(int i, int j) { return j... replacecopy( ) 被引量: 0发表: 0年 Codebook Left-Right (LR) Party Scores Variablelrlr_implr_unstdlr_corelr_core_imp lr_core_unstd...
int i_; int *p_ = &i_; explicit Evil(int i) : i_(i) {} Evil(const volatile Evil&) = delete; template<class = void> Evil(const Evil& rhs) noexcept : i_(rhs.i_) { puts("Appropriately evil!"); } ~Evil() = default; ...
stda program for computing excited states and response functions via simplified TD-DFT methods (sTDA, sTD-DFT, and SF-sTD-DFT) - stda-for-phreeqc-plus/intpack.f90 at master · alanliska/stda-for-phreeqc-plus
std::deque<int>c1(3,100);//初始化一个int行的双端队列c1,此时c1 = {100, 100, 100}autoit = c1.begin(); it = c1.insert(it,200);//在it前插入元素200//c1 = {200,100, 100, 100}c1.insert(it,2,300);//在it前插入两个元素值都为300//c1 = {300,300,200,100, 100, 100}//...
// constructing vectors#include<iostream>#include<vector>intmain(){// constructors used in the same order as described above:std::vector<int> first;// empty vector of intsstd::vector<int>second(4,100);// four ints with value 100std::vector<int>third(second.begin(),second.end());//...
std::list<int> nums1 {3,1,4,6,5,9}; std::list<int> nums2; std::list<int> nums3;// 从 nums1 复制赋值数据到 nums2nums2 = nums1;//此时nums2 = {3, 1, 4, 6, 5, 9}// 从 nums1 移动赋值数据到 nums3,// 修改 nums1 和 nums3nums3 = std::move(nums1);//此时 nums1...